just talked with Paul Davidson, a hydraullic engineer in salt lake, who's partially in charge of the flows.

he said they just increased it by 50 cfs to 750 and expect to increase by nother 50 or 100 by the weekends end to 850. he said this will probably be the maximum this year. also, the flow should hold around 700+ all of july and the first part of august. then they expect to bring in down slowly.
